推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
PHP与SQLite的组合为构建轻量级Web应用程序提供了高效、灵活的解决方案。SQLite作为轻量级数据库,与PHP的紧密结合,不仅简化了开发流程,还降低了系统资源消耗,使得Web应用在性能和部署上更具优势。这一黄金组合,特别适用于中小型项目,助力开发者快速实现功能丰富、响应迅速的网络应用。
本文目录导读:
在Web开发领域,PHP和SQLite的组合被广泛认为是构建轻量级Web应用程序的黄金组合,这两种技术都具有简单易用、高效稳定的特点,使得它们在小型项目和个人项目中得到了广泛的应用,本文将详细介绍PHP与SQLite的特点、优势以及如何在项目中使用这两种技术。
PHP与SQLite简介
1、PHP
PHP(Hypertext Preprocessor)是一种流行的服务器端脚本语言,主要用于Web开发,PHP易于学习,功能强大,支持多种数据库和协议,自从1995年诞生以来,PHP已经成为全球最受欢迎的Web开发语言之一。
2、SQLite
SQLite是一种轻量级的数据库管理系统,它是一个嵌入式的数据库,不需要单独的服务器进程,SQLite具有体积小、速度快、易于配置和使用等特点,适用于小型项目和移动应用程序。
PHP与SQLite的优势
1、简单易用
PHP和SQLite都具有简单易用的特点,PHP的语法简洁,易于上手,适合初学者学习,SQLite的操作也非常简单,不需要复杂的配置和安装过程,可以直接集成到项目中。
2、高效稳定
PHP和SQLite在性能上都非常优秀,PHP执行速度快,支持多种数据库和协议,可以轻松应对各种Web应用场景,SQLite在处理小型数据集时具有很高的性能,适用于轻量级Web应用程序。
3、开源免费
PHP和SQLite都是开源软件,可以免费使用,这意味着开发者可以节省大量的成本,将更多的精力投入到项目开发中。
4、跨平台支持
PHP和SQLite都支持多种操作系统,如Windows、Linux、Mac OS等,这使得开发者可以在不同的平台上开发、部署和运行应用程序。
PHP与SQLite在项目中的应用
1、数据库连接
在PHP中使用SQLite,首先需要连接到SQLite数据库,可以使用以下代码创建或连接到一个SQLite数据库:
$db = new SQLite3('example.db');
2、数据库操作
在连接到SQLite数据库后,可以使用PHP进行各种数据库操作,如创建表、插入数据、查询数据、更新数据等。
- 创建表:
$db->exec("C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, username TEXT, password TEXT)");
- 插入数据:
$stmt = $db->prepare('INSERT INTO users (username, password) VALUES (:username, :password)'); $stmt->bindValue(':username', $username); $stmt->bindValue(':password', $password); $stmt->execute();
- 查询数据:
$result = $db->query('SELECT * FROM users'); while ($row = $result->fetchArray()) { echo $row['username']; }
- 更新数据:
$stmt = $db->prepare('UPDATE users SET password = :password WHERE username = :username'); $stmt->bindValue(':username', $username); $stmt->bindValue(':password', $password); $stmt->execute();
3、数据库关闭
在完成数据库操作后,需要关闭数据库连接,以释放资源:
$db->close();
PHP与SQLite的组合为开发者提供了一个简单、高效、稳定的Web开发环境,在小型项目和个人项目中,使用PHP与SQLite可以大大降低开发成本,提高开发效率,掌握这两种技术,将为开发者打开Web开发的大门,助力其在互联网行业取得成功。
相关关键词:PHP, SQLite, Web开发, 轻量级, 简单易用, 高效稳定, 开源免费, 跨平台, 数据库连接, 数据库操作, 创建表, 插入数据, 查询数据, 更新数据, 数据库关闭, 开发成本, 开发效率, 互联网行业, 成功, 项目, 应用, 技术选型, 系统架构, 性能优化, 安全性, 扩展性, 维护, 学习曲线, 社区支持, 资源消耗, 系统要求, 兼容性, 调试, 错误处理, 性能测试, 数据库设计, 数据库优化, 缓存, 数据迁移, 数据备份, 数据恢复, 数据库管理工具, 开发环境配置, 项目管理, 团队协作, 测试, 部署, 运维
本文标签属性:
轻量级Web应用程序:轻量级web应用程序是什么